On Tue, 05 Apr 2022, Christian König <[email protected]> wrote:
> Am 05.04.22 um 19:36 schrieb Grigory Vasilyev:
>> Using memset on local arrays before exiting the function is pointless.
>> Compilator will remove this code. Also for local arrays is preferable to
>> use {0} instead of memset. Mistakes are often made when working with
>> memset.
>
> Well actually memset is preferred when working with structures which are 
> given to the hardware parser because {0} won't initialize paddings.

Not that I'd know anything that's going on here... but it sure seems
strange to me to be passing unpacked structures where the padding might
matter to a "hardware parser".
